The City of Shannon Hills has issued a statement to confirm with SH Water customers that they are NOT currently under a boil order. However, there is a countywide emergency water conservation order. They are asking residents not to run dishwashers or washing machines, and limit your use of tap water during cooking, bathing and […]

Warmer day temps melting some snow but dangerous refreezing happening evenings through Saturday
Warmer temperatures began to melt snow on Thursday, and will again on Friday, BUT very cold overnight temperatures will lead to refreezing. This makes for extremely hazardous driving conditions for any surfaces that remain wet/slushy/snow covered through this weekend. The primary mornings where refreezing is expected to cause the most hazardous driving conditions are Friday and […]
